In the Han River Park

When the gentle wind blows

A colorful kite

I fly over that high blue sky

Am I no different from any young man?

Like a string of loose, tangled and broken kites

Sometimes blue youth fail to get a job

To drive the young people

Freely

Like a colorful kite flying high in the sky

Sometimes it bears success and fruit.

I don't know when my kite will be free
